1 В избранное 0 Ответвления 0

OSCHINA-MIRROR/open-iita-iotkit-parent

Клонировать/Скачать
待优化项.md 4.5 КБ
Копировать Редактировать Web IDE Исходные данные Просмотреть построчно История
Отправлено 09.06.2025 12:13 fd8c366

1. Потенциальные улучшения backend

Оптимизация плагинов !!!!

Текущий код плагинов слишком тяжел, требует оптимизации. Удаление плагинов содержит ошибки, в большинстве случаев удаление невозможно. При активации плагина не всегда активируется последняя версия, возможно, связано с удалением.

Оптимизация кэша

Оптимизация информации в кэше

Сканирование SonarLint

Сканирование SonarLint, исправление кода согласно рекомендациям

Путь к интерфейсу

Постарайтесь не использовать параметры пути, а размещайте пути непосредственно в интерфейсах, а не в константах

Избыточные методы и классы

Удалите неиспользуемые избыточные методы и классы

Логирование

Добавьте перехватчик для логирования SQL, чтобы упростить SQL
Добавить requestid на основе MDC -- завершено

Права доступа к данным

Переделать существующий checkOwner в универсальный и оформить документацию

Регулярные задачи в правиле управления

Добавить задержку выполнения для конкретных дат

Продукты

Классификация продуктов Исправление неактивного изменения изображений продуктов

Центр уведомлений

Разделение заголовков в шаблонах уведомлений, поддержка замены шаблонов

Потребление уведомлений устройств

Переход от одиночного вставления к пакетному, установка ограничений и таймаута## Центр управления тревогами Частота тревог

iot-manager

Объединение слоя сервисных интерфейсов, интерфейсов и реализации

iot-component-oss

Добавление локального способа хранения файлов

iot-components

Извлечение репозитория

Улучшение стандартов проекта

Добавление поля requestid в загрузке файлов

Инициализация общего SystemApplicationRunner SysOssConfigServiceImpl

Унификация аннотаций кэширования

Отсутствие интерфейсов на главной странице

Интерфейс экспорта продуктов

Названия полей в базе данных

Унификация полей даты создания, даты обновления, создателя, обновителя, флага удаления, даты удаления и удалителя

Компоненты связи

Унификация загрузки файлов, компонента jar загрузки requestid, локальной загрузки файлов, изменения конфигурации типов загрузки файлов

Генератор кода

Улучшение фронтенд-генератора кода

Многопользовательская система

Текущая поддержка нескольких пользователей ограничивается несколькими таблицами Также требуется поддержка для MQ, Redis и т.д.

Modbus

Реализация циклического опроса Modbus в облаке

2. В разработке

Функция Модуль Описание
Управление потоками видео
Управление умными краями

Опубликовать ( 0 )

Вы можете оставить комментарий после Вход в систему

1
https://api.gitlife.ru/oschina-mirror/open-iita-iotkit-parent.git
git@api.gitlife.ru:oschina-mirror/open-iita-iotkit-parent.git
oschina-mirror
open-iita-iotkit-parent
open-iita-iotkit-parent
V0.5.x